Are bouncy/blown shocks covered under warranty?

So my car has 60k miles on it and I purchased an extended warranty until 2011 or 2012 (I forget exactly) and I'm wondering if I bring my car in completely stock if they will replace the shocks because they are really bouncy and feel blown.

Any opinions or experience would be appreciated

I asked this same question a week back. The service manager told me that shocks are not covered by warranty and extended warranty. They are a wear and tear item.

60k is plenty of mileage on a shock, so it's not like you're looking at a premature failure. If it happened in the first 10-20k or so of ownership, I'm sure most dealers would replace a blown shock, but since you're beyond the reasonable wear expectation, I doubt they'll cover it. Never hurts to ask, though.
